X-Git-Url: http://gitweb.michael.orlitzky.com/?a=blobdiff_plain;f=mjo-linear_algebra.tex;h=9e32d2179a25e1d061eeeb1f063ed14bcdf36284;hb=42aadc60bddb32104aa8269f9db5e3cfe057816e;hp=955dd3a3347e4db45c5f251dba877a68acdd34a2;hpb=ec4f08ce7089e080f8f1afd7d566d400651dfbca;p=mjotex.git diff --git a/mjo-linear_algebra.tex b/mjo-linear_algebra.tex index 955dd3a..9e32d21 100644 --- a/mjo-linear_algebra.tex +++ b/mjo-linear_algebra.tex @@ -43,8 +43,19 @@ % The ``write a big vector as a matrix'' operator. \newcommand*{\matricize}[1]{ \operatorname{mat} \of{{#1}} } -% The inverse of the adjoint of an operator (the argument). -\newcommand*{\adjinv}[1]{ \left( {#1}^{*} \right)^{-1} } - % An inline column vector, with parentheses and a transpose operator. \newcommand*{\colvec}[1]{ \left( {#1} \right)^{T} } + +% Bounded linear operators on some space. The required argument is the +% domain of those operators, and the optional argument is the +% codomain. If the optional argument is omitted, the required argument +% is used for both. +\newcommand*{\boundedops}[2][]{ + \mathcal{B}\of{ {#2} + \if\relax\detokenize{#1}\relax + {}% + \else + {,{#1}}% + \fi + } +}